Thetford Mines Dairy Joy

A Thetford Mines institution for over 60 years, this snack bar is the essence of retro. A pogo, a poutine and a cornet “Soleil”, an ice cream cone with 9 coulis, a true 3-course meal!

WE GO FOR

Their Italian sandwich. A real delight that goes well with poutine.

Lévis Ferme Phylum

Here’s a snack bar in the heart of a cheese factory. As you may have guessed, the cheese in the poutine is theirs! Interestingly, owner Patrick’s favorite is the cheeseburger. An ice cream sandwich for dessert is never too much!

WE GO FOR

The Foodtruck Poutine! Fresh homemade cheese, a perfect potato and a signature sauce that’s sure to wow!

Saint-Narcisse-de-Beaurivage Casse-croûte Chez Demers

With a rating of 4.7/5 on Google, we couldn’t pass up this snack bar in the Lotbinière area. Their fries are a big hit with customers. Maybe it has something to do with the fact that they make them themselves every day!

WE GO FOR

A pizza with fries, a hamburger with fries, a poutine with fries… as long as there are fries!

Lévis Casse-croûte Patate-O-Bec

Located just 200 meters from the Parc régional de la Pointe-De la Martinière, it’s the perfect spot for a little reward after a day’s cycling on the Parcours des Anses.

WE GO FOR

The perfect ratio of fries to cheese to sauce in their poutines, and their courteous service.

L'Islet Casse-croûte Rétro

Right on the Route des Navigateurs, this retro-style snack bar and dairy bar will satisfy your craving for poutine and hot dogs! Once you’ve placed your order, head to Parc du Quai, just across the street, to dine face-to-face with the river.

WE GO FOR

For the retro music that’s always playing, and even to choose a song from the Jukebox.
